Skip to content

Conversation

@kosticia
Copy link
Contributor

@kosticia kosticia commented Jul 11, 2025

About the PR

This pr renames cryogenic sleep unit into hypersleep unit. Also, it renames cryogenics access into hypersleep access.

Why / Balance

Resolves #25406.
Hypersleep is the most liked suggestion in #25406. Also, “hyper” prefix used only in hyperlathes that makes it less confusing variant.

Technical details

Every Cryogenic mention has been changed to Hypersleep

Breaking changes

Here all migrated entities:

CryogenicSleepUnitSpawnerLateJoin: HyperSleepUnitSpawnerLateJoin
CryogenicSleepUnitSpawner: HyperSleepUnitSpawner
CryogenicSleepUnit: HyperSleepUnitSpawner
SignCryo: SignHyperSleep
SignDirectionalCryo: SignDirectionalHyperSleep
DefaultStationBeaconCryosleep: DefaultStationBeaconHypersleep
HolopadGeneralCryosleep: HolopadGeneralHypersleep

Other changes are just locales/sprites/partical yml.

Requirements

Changelog
🆑

  • tweak: Cryogenic sleep units are now called hypersleep units, to avoid confusion.

@kosticia kosticia requested a review from crazybrain23 as a code owner July 11, 2025 09:30
@PJBot PJBot added S: Needs Review Status: Requires additional reviews before being fully accepted. Not to be replaced by S: Approved. Changes: No C# Changes: Requires no C# knowledge to review or fix this item. S: Untriaged Status: Indicates an item has not been triaged and doesn't have appropriate labels. labels Jul 11, 2025
@github-actions github-actions bot added the size/S Denotes a PR that changes 10-99 lines. label Jul 11, 2025
Copy link
Member

@TheShuEd TheShuEd left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

also need rename prototypes & update migrations

@PJBot PJBot added S: Awaiting Changes Status: Changes are required before another review can happen and removed S: Needs Review Status: Requires additional reviews before being fully accepted. Not to be replaced by S: Approved. labels Jul 11, 2025
@kosticia
Copy link
Contributor Author

also need rename prototypes & update migrations

Access prototype too?

@PJBot PJBot added the Changes: Sprites Changes: Might require knowledge of spriting or visual design. label Jul 11, 2025
@github-actions
Copy link
Contributor

github-actions bot commented Jul 11, 2025

RSI Diff Bot; head commit 8b59726 merging into 42c519b
This PR makes changes to 1 or more RSIs. Here is a summary of all changes:

Resources/Textures/Structures/Wallmounts/signs.rsi

State Old New Status
cryo Removed
direction_cryo Removed
direction_sleep Added
sleep Added

Edit: diff updated after 8b59726

@Simyon264
Copy link
Member

Renaming the prototype is a huge breaking change. I wouldn't rename the prototype, just change the entity name

@TheShuEd TheShuEd dismissed their stale review July 11, 2025 11:37

meh, ok

kosticia added 5 commits July 11, 2025 15:44
This reverts commit 4cdcfa6.
This reverts commit 81f875f.
This reverts commit 35672de.
This reverts commit 3723bc6.
Copy link
Contributor

@EmoGarbage404 EmoGarbage404 left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

The larger cryo sign needs to be updated. You can find the sign font in the template subdirectory inside of the textures folder.

@EmoGarbage404 EmoGarbage404 added the S: Art Approval Status: The art (e.g. Spritework) has been approved by an art lead. label Jul 11, 2025
@Cojoke-dot
Copy link
Contributor

Uhhh, 2 things:

  1. Cryo Station beacon, I don't think I saw that name changed in the pr
  2. When you select your starting location in the spawn menu, either from cryosleep or shuttle, idk if you got that but want to make sure.

@K-Dynamic
Copy link
Contributor

Renaming the prototype is a huge breaking change. I wouldn't rename the prototype, just change the entity name

I think it might be needed since the point is to avoid confusion with cryopods for both players and backend coding

@kosticia
Copy link
Contributor Author

I think it might be needed since the point is to avoid confusion with cryopods for both players and backend coding

Forks are really love to add everlasting blueshilds, brigmedics and other amazing roles with cryogenics access. This change will be really painful.

@deltanedas
Copy link
Contributor

its just a yml linter error, not hard to fix

@kosticia
Copy link
Contributor Author

its just a yml linter error, not hard to fix

looks like you have never seen REAL russian forks and its developers

@github-actions
Copy link
Contributor

This pull request has conflicts, please resolve those before we can evaluate the pull request.

@github-actions github-actions bot added the S: Merge Conflict Status: Needs to resolve merge conflicts before it can be accepted label Jul 26, 2025
@github-actions github-actions bot added S: Merge Conflict Status: Needs to resolve merge conflicts before it can be accepted and removed S: Merge Conflict Status: Needs to resolve merge conflicts before it can be accepted labels Jul 27, 2025
@github-actions
Copy link
Contributor

github-actions bot commented Aug 1, 2025

This pull request has conflicts, please resolve those before we can evaluate the pull request.

@ToastEnjoyer ToastEnjoyer added P3: Standard Priority: Default priority for repository items. T: New Feature Type: New feature or content, or extending existing content A: General Interactions Area: General in-game interactions that don't relate to another area. and removed S: Untriaged Status: Indicates an item has not been triaged and doesn't have appropriate labels. labels Aug 6, 2025
@github-actions github-actions bot added S: Merge Conflict Status: Needs to resolve merge conflicts before it can be accepted and removed S: Merge Conflict Status: Needs to resolve merge conflicts before it can be accepted labels Aug 8, 2025
@github-actions
Copy link
Contributor

github-actions bot commented Aug 9, 2025

This pull request has conflicts, please resolve those before we can evaluate the pull request.

@github-actions github-actions bot removed the S: Merge Conflict Status: Needs to resolve merge conflicts before it can be accepted label Aug 11, 2025
@github-actions
Copy link
Contributor

This pull request has conflicts, please resolve those before we can evaluate the pull request.

@github-actions github-actions bot added the S: Merge Conflict Status: Needs to resolve merge conflicts before it can be accepted label Aug 31, 2025
@github-actions github-actions bot added S: Merge Conflict Status: Needs to resolve merge conflicts before it can be accepted and removed S: Merge Conflict Status: Needs to resolve merge conflicts before it can be accepted labels Sep 30, 2025
@github-actions
Copy link
Contributor

github-actions bot commented Oct 4, 2025

This pull request has conflicts, please resolve those before we can evaluate the pull request.

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

A: General Interactions Area: General in-game interactions that don't relate to another area. Changes: No C# Changes: Requires no C# knowledge to review or fix this item. Changes: Sprites Changes: Might require knowledge of spriting or visual design. P3: Standard Priority: Default priority for repository items. S: Art Approval Status: The art (e.g. Spritework) has been approved by an art lead. S: Awaiting Changes Status: Changes are required before another review can happen S: Merge Conflict Status: Needs to resolve merge conflicts before it can be accepted size/S Denotes a PR that changes 10-99 lines. T: New Feature Type: New feature or content, or extending existing content

Projects

None yet

Development

Successfully merging this pull request may close these issues.

"Cryo" is confusing and should be renamed

9 participants